Default Sharing printer issue

Hello.
I have 4 computers connected to my wireless network.The main one connected
to a local Printer,sharing all 4 computers with no problem , but recently
added a new laptop vista ultimate to my network,the printer is visible on
the laptop,but when I go to print,
I have error message(windows need file INF to preside the installation.

Any idea???

Thanks

Try to add the printer as local printer first and then remap it. This search
result may help.

Vista Print Issues
Solved: Vista print Error 0x00000866 Resolution: 1. Add a Local
Printer and then create a new port pointing to the shared printer. ...
